Entegra issues question

Hey all you Entegra types, I'm looking to see if you all have any major issues with anything Entegra has put out so far. I've done some looking at other forums, and there seems to be no lack of things to gripe about, but I don't see any major deal breakers here. The wife and I have Entegra on our short list, as well as Winnebago/Itasca and American Coach. We've seen the Winnebago windshield nightmare posts, but since we can't even see an Entegra until we take a road trip, the forums are all we have to look at as far as the MH is concerned and we haven't seen anything major yet. Any major issues out there, or is Cinderella able to stay at the ball a few more hours?

We've experienced a couple a what I would consider bigger issues. DEF issue, 315 tires rubbing and a AC issue. That said, Entegra has blown me away with their customer service and response times. They even flew out a spartan expert to resolve the tire/ airbag issue. I couldn't be more impressed with their professionalism, time of response, and desire to make sure we are completely happy. I can report their mission was accomplished. Joyce and Don (customer support) are nothing short of amazing.
